IP查询
查询
你查询的IP:[203.196.231.198] 地理位置:印度
最新查询
119.248.255.123
116.128.64.22
219.224.233.218
222.160.181.129
124.248.229.106
124.128.221.122
220.160.135.163
59.80.173.206
118.242.176.196
123.138.184.248
203.196.231.198
202.43.144.110
202.127.224.200
116.208.222.69
210.15.128.46
203.166.160.51
121.101.208.161
117.22.7.161
202.14.235.189
117.40.159.143
203.94.127.196
60.253.128.237
202.127.128.33
122.204.79.100
125.64.154.125
59.80.21.118
119.40.64.123
119.59.128.113
202.164.162.249
116.255.128.204
59.108.131.215
123.49.128.54